2019-06-11drm/fb-helper: Remove drm_fb_helper_connectorNoralf Trønnes2-59/+36
All drivers add all their connectors so there's no need to keep around an array of available connectors. Instead we just put the useable (not writeback) connectors in a temporary array using drm_client_for_each_connector_iter() everytime we probe the outputs. Other places where it's necessary to look at the connectors, we just iterate over them using the same iterator function. 2019-06-11irqchip/gic-v2m: Add support for Amazon Graviton variant of GICv3+GICv2mZeev Zilberman2-3/+5
Add support for Amazon Graviton custom variant of GICv2m, where the message is encoded using the MSI message address, as opposed to standard GICv2m, where the SPI number is encoded in the MSI message data. In addition, the Graviton flavor of GICv2m is used along GICv3 (and not GICv2). 2019-06-10bpf: Allow bpf_map_lookup_elem() on an xskmapJonathan Lemon3-2/+14
Currently, the AF_XDP code uses a separate map in order to determine if an xsk is bound to a queue. Instead of doing this, have bpf_map_lookup_elem() return a xdp_sock. Rearrange some xdp_sock members to eliminate structure holes. Remove selftest - will be added back in later patch. 2019-06-10ipv6: Allow routes to use nexthop objectsDavid Ahern1-0/+1
Add support for RTA_NH_ID attribute to allow a user to specify a nexthop id to use with a route. fc_nh_id is added to fib6_config to hold the value passed in the RTA_NH_ID attribute. If a nexthop id is given, the gateway, device, encap and multipath attributes can not be set. Update ip6_route_del to check metric and protocol before nexthop specs. If fc_nh_id is set, then it must match the id in the route entry. Since IPv6 allows delete of a cached entry (an exception), add ip6_del_cached_rt_nh to cycle through all of the fib6_nh in a fib entry if it is using a nexthop. 2019-06-10nexthops: Add ipv6 helper to walk all fib6_nh in a nexthop structDavid Ahern1-0/+4
IPv6 has traditionally had a single fib6_nh per fib6_info. With nexthops we can have multiple fib6_nh associated with a fib6_info. Add a nexthop helper to invoke a callback for each fib6_nh in a 'struct nexthop'. If the callback returns non-0, the loop is stopped and the return value passed to the caller. 2019-06-10mm/hmm: Hold a mmgrab from hmm to mmJason Gunthorpe1-3/+0
So long as a struct hmm pointer exists, so should the struct mm it is linked too. Hold the mmgrab() as soon as a hmm is created, and mmdrop() it once the hmm refcount goes to zero. Since mmdrop() (ie a 0 kref on struct mm) is now impossible with a !NULL mm->hmm delete the hmm_hmm_destroy(). 2019-06-10mm/hmm: Use hmm_mirror not mm as an argument for hmm_range_registerJason Gunthorpe1-3/+4
Ralph observes that hmm_range_register() can only be called by a driver while a mirror is registered. Make this clear in the API by passing in the mirror structure as a parameter. This also simplifies understanding the lifetime model for struct hmm, as the hmm pointer must be valid as part of a registered mirror so all we need in hmm_register_range() is a simple kref_get.
